OPERATION
Turn-On Checkout Procedure
The following checkout procedure describes the use of the
front panel controls and indicators illustrated in Figure 2 arxJ
ensures that the supply is operational:
a. Push LINE button to ON.
b. Set RANGE push button to desired range.
c. Turn VOLTAGE control fully counter clockwise to
ensure that output decreases to 0 Vdc then fully
clockwise to ensure that output voltage increases to
the maximum output voltage.
d.
While depressing CC SET push button, turn the
CURRENT control fully counter clockwise and then
fully clockwise to ensure that the current limit value
can be set from zero to maximum rated value.
e. Connect load to output terminals.

Constant Current Operation
To set up a power supply for a constant current operation,
proceed as follows:
a. Turn CURRENT control fully counter clockwise to
ensure that output decreases to 0 A, and then turn on
power supply.
b. Adjust VOLTAGE controKno load connected) for
maximum output voltage allowable(voltage limit), as
determined by load cor>ditions. During actual operation,
if a load change causes the voltage limit to be
exceeded,
the power supply will automatically crossover to constant voltage operation at the preset
voltage limit and output current will drop proportionately.
c. Adjust CURRENT control for desired output current
while depressing CC SET button(CC LED will not light
until the supply is loaded)

Constant Voltage Operation
To set up a power supply for a constant voltage operation,
proceed as follows:
a. Turn on power supply and adjust 10-turn VOLTAGE
control for desired output voltage(output terminals
open). CV LED should light.
b. While depressing CC SET push button, adjust 10-turn
CURRENT control for maximum output current allowable (current limit). During actual operation, if a load
change causes the current limit to be exceeded, the
power supply will automatically crossover to constant
current mode artd output voltage will drop proportionately.
Each load should be connected to the power supply output
terminals using separate pairs of connecting wires. This will
minimize mutual coupling effects between loads and will
retain full advantage of the low output impedance of the
power supply. Each pair of connecting wires should be as
short as possible and twisted or shielded to reduce noise
pickupdf a shield is used, connect one end to the power
supply ground terminal and leave the other erxl unconnected.).
Operation Beyond Rated Output
The output controls can adjust the voltage or current to
values above(up to 5%) the rated output as indicated on the
front panel display. Although the supply can be operated in
the 5% overrange region without being damaged, it can not
be guaranteed to meet all of its performance specifications
in this region.
